Output d92ec1eb467c87e76063db7d15f60afb97c7139157359b9da92fbe559a749762:3

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8869a59d8767adefd4b27cab9824c34d1e1c48e6 OP_EQUAL
address
3E8JP7MhdGUGyQrdNcprCovUWDQbrecxam
transaction
d92ec1eb467c87e76063db7d15f60afb97c7139157359b9da92fbe559a749762
confirmations
260013
spent
true